General of the North Ai Nengqi Boss Guide
General of the North Ai Nengqi is an optional boss encountered in Wuchang: Fallen Feathers. This guide covers his weaknesses, resistances, location, strategies for the fight, and the rewards you’ll receive for defeating him.
Weaknesses & Resistances
Section titled “Weaknesses & Resistances”Damage Type Weakness
Section titled “Damage Type Weakness”While specific elemental weaknesses are still under investigation, Ai Nengqi is particularly vulnerable to a certain type of physical damage.
- Recommended: Blunt Attacks Ai Nengqi has low mitigation against Blunt attacks. This means weapons and attacks with the Blunt property will deal significantly more damage compared to Slash or Stab attacks.
How to Beat General of the North Ai Nengqi
Section titled “How to Beat General of the North Ai Nengqi”This fight requires careful management of status effects and knowing when to create openings. Follow these strategies to gain an advantage.

Summon Nian Suichang to Split Aggro
Immediately upon entering the boss arena, use the Bone Whistle to summon your companion, Nian Suichang. Be aware that using the whistle triggers an animation during which you are vulnerable. Once summoned, Ai Nengqi will often change targets to attack Nian Suichang, giving you a crucial window to deal damage or heal.

Use Lightning Attacks
As an armored foe, Ai Nengqi is susceptible to Lightning damage. You can leverage this weakness in two primary ways:
- Bone Needle - Lightning: Unlock this skill node in the Impetus Repository.
- Thunderstorm: This powerful spell is dropped by an elite enemy located near the Rebel Camp shrine. Defeating this enemy also grants you the Rebel Camp Key, which is required to access Ai Nengqi’s arena.

Equip for Resistance
Ai Nengqi inflicts multiple status ailments. He uses attacks that build up Frostbite and Paralysis. When his health drops to about 50%, he imbues his sword with fire, adding Burn to his arsenal. Equip armor with high resistances to these three status effects to reduce their buildup and avoid being incapacitated.

Utilize Skyborn Might
When Ai Nengqi leaps into the air to fire his bow, perform a perfect dodge against his first arrow. This will grant you the Skyborn Might buff. After gaining the buff, maintain your distance from him. This will bait him into firing more arrows, allowing you to stack the effect and increase your damage output.
Cheese Strategy: Use the Arena Entrance for Cover
Section titled “Cheese Strategy: Use the Arena Entrance for Cover”For a safer, albeit less reliable, approach, lure Ai Nengqi towards the sides of the arena. There’s a chance he will jump to a corner near the entrance to fire his arrows. If he does, you can position yourself behind the impassable terrain at the entrance, which will block his shots. This provides a safe opportunity to heal, reapply weapon buffs, or use items.
Note that this method is not guaranteed to work. Ai Nengqi may land in a different spot where his arrows can still reach you.
Ai Nengqi Moveset
Section titled “Ai Nengqi Moveset”Ai Nengqi’s attack patterns change once his health is reduced to 50%.
Attack Patterns at 100% HP
Section titled “Attack Patterns at 100% HP”Move | Details |
---|---|
Ground Slam | Leaps into the air and slams down. Dodge forward as he lands to get behind him and use a heavy charged attack to open him up for an Obliterate Strike. |
Ground Stomp | Raises his foot and stomps, creating a small area-of-effect shockwave. Dodge to the side and prepare for a follow-up attack. |
Ice Punch | Delivers a punch with his right arm, infused with Frostbite. Dodge to your left to evade. |
Dual Slash | Performs two wide slashes, first from left to right, then right to left. Dodge backward to stay out of range. |
Airborne Slash | Slashes his sword upward from the ground. If it connects, it will launch you into the air. Dodge to the sides. |
Crouching Slash | Executes a spinning slash that ends with him in a crouching position. Dodge forward through the attack to capitalize on the brief opening. |
Uppercut | A quick upward slash from his side. Dodge in any direction to avoid. |
Sword Slams | Slams his sword onto the ground four consecutive times. Stick close to him and dodge to your left with each slam, then counter with a heavy attack. |
Overhead Slash | Raises his sword high above his head for a powerful downward strike. Dodge to the side and punish him from behind. |
Ice Spikes | Grips the ground and hurls a volley of ice spikes that erupt from the ground around you. Dodge sideways to get a clear view of his next move. |
Lightning Shot | Fires a single explosive arrow at your location. Dodge to the side to avoid the arrow and the subsequent explosion. |
Lightning Volley | Nocks five Lightning-infused arrows and fires them at you, which build up Paralysis. Dodge forward through the volley. |
Lightning Strike | Jumps into the air while performing an upward slash, then fires a single arrow at you before landing. Dodge to the sides to bait more arrow shots for Skyborn Might. |
Added Attack Patterns at 50% HP
Section titled “Added Attack Patterns at 50% HP”Move | Details |
---|---|
Frost Wave | At 50% HP, he stomps the ground, releasing a wide wave of frosty mist. Dodge forward through the wave to get behind him for a counter-attack. |
Imbued Flames | Ignites his sword and performs a series of spinning slashes. The final spin releases bouncing fireballs. Dodge backward to create distance. |
Spinning Flame Arc | Leaps and spins with his flaming sword, striking as he lands. Dodge to the side, or dodge forward just as he lands to attack his back. |
Billow Volley | Fires arrows into the sky that rain down in an expanding circular pattern around you. Dodge forward or backward with each wave; dodging sideways will likely get you hit. |
Ai Nengqi Location
Section titled “Ai Nengqi Location”You can find the General of the North Ai Nengqi in the Cloudspire Outskirts. From the Rebel Camp shrine, follow the path that leads downward and to the left. Continue left at the next fork to reach the boss arena.
Drops & Rewards
Section titled “Drops & Rewards”Boss Drops
Section titled “Boss Drops”Defeating General of the North Ai Nengqi rewards you with the following items:
Item | Quantity |
---|---|
Echo of Ai Nengqi | 1 |
Flamebringer | 1 |
Seven Treasure Rosary | 1 |
White Jade Dumpling | 1 |
Items from the Seven Treasure Rosary
Section titled “Items from the Seven Treasure Rosary”After obtaining the Seven Treasure Rosary, give it to the merchant Tao Qing. This will unlock Ai Nengqi’s armor set for purchase in her shop.
- North General’s Helmet
- North General’s Armor
- North General’s Vambraces
- North General’s War Boots
